Suspect in North Sacramento stabbing death of 21-year-old turns himself in
A 23-year-old Sacramento man has been arrested in connection with a fatal weekend stabbing in North Sacramento.
Eugene Brooks turned himself in to the Sacramento County Main Jail on Monday evening and was booked on suspicion of murder, the Sacramento Police Department said in an update Tuesday. He remains in custody without bail, according to jail records.
The stabbing in the city’s South Hagginwood neighborhood occurred just before 1 a.m. Saturday in the 2700 block of Rio Linda Boulevard. Officers found a 21-year-old man with at least one stab wound. He was pronounced dead at the scene, according to police.
Authorities identified Brooks during the investigation and issued a warrant for his arrest. He is scheduled to appear in Sacramento Superior Court on Thursday.
The Sacramento County Coroner’s Office identified the victim as Dillion Case Lewis Jr. of Sacramento.
